About the Role
The Software Developer I is an early-career software engineer responsible for designing, implementing, testing, and supporting application features across modern distributed systems. Working as part of an Agile team, this individual contributes to new feature development as well as enhancements to existing applications and products.
Responsibilities
- Design, build, test, and maintain application features across system layers, including user interfaces, services, APIs, and data.
- Deliver small to medium-sized features with increasing independence.
- Contribute to application enhancements, bug fixes, technical improvements, and ongoing maintenance.
- Write clean, maintainable, efficient, and well-structured code aligned with team standards.
- Follow established software development, security, and architecture practices.
- Use AI-assisted development tools to: Accelerate implementation and reduce repetitive work. Generate test cases, documentation, and code scaffolding. Explore alternative solutions and implementation approaches. Support troubleshooting, learning, and code improvement. Critically review and validate AI-generated outputs for correctness, security, performance, and maintainability.
- Ensure all AI-assisted work complies with organizational standards and approved development practices.
- Develop and maintain unit and integration tests.
- Participate in code reviews and apply feedback from other developers.
- Support debugging, troubleshooting, and root cause analysis.
- Contribute to the continuous improvement of application quality and reliability.
- Collaborate and deliver with technical and nontechnical stakeholders throughout the development process.
- Document technical changes, design decisions, application behavior, and support considerations.
